Problem 2(7 points)(Q0: 3100%)
It is desired to design a gear box as shown in the figure. Following information must be
followed:
Gears type: Spur
Smallest possible size gears
To avoid interference, number of teeth on
the smallest gear should not be less than 14
Maintain exact speed ratio
Input and output shafts are collinear
Input speed =3000rpm
Output speed =150rpm
Module =2.5mm
Pressure angle =20
Power =7.5kW
Analyze the gear box and:
a) Calculate the number of teeth of all gears.
b) Determine the shafts center distance c1 and c2(in mm )
c) Draw FBD showing all forces on gear 3 and 4 with the countershaft at A and B.
d) Calculate forces exerted by gear 2 on gear 3 and gear 5 on gear 4.
e) Calculate the countershaft forces at A and B.
f) What is the output torque of the shaft attached to gear 5? Neglect frictional
losses.
